Job description
With an increased appetite for consuming data and regulatory pressure to demonstrate data quality coverage we need to maintain high standards in Data Quality. Global Data Quality function is responsible for operationalizing ING Data Quality strategy, translating into services and executing globally to ensure we maintain those high standards for ING data across the globe. As an Operations Lead in the Global Data Quality team, you will be part of Data Operations and will be key in delivering our promise of “ensuring data quality” for ING across the globe.
Key Responsibilities
- Design data quality services that are easily expandable to new domains/countries
- Work on the expansion of data quality to other domains & countries and standardization and centralization of our efforts across the globe
- Operationalize and implement data quality services that provide insights into our data and drive remediation to improve the overall quality posture of ING
- Drive and foster a culture of inclusive cross-border collaboration
- Identify gaps and inefficiencies in data operations processes, devising and executing plans for continuous improvement.
- Define, implement, and continuously enhance the end-to-end data quality operating and service model across data domains.
- Maximize the principles of digitalization to ensure our human efforts are focused on improving our client experience.
- Optimize our workforce across teams and locations
- Set-up capabilities to ensure we shift from reactive to a proactive approach on how we ensure data quality.
- Ensure strong cooperation and aligned execution of data quality practices across entities.
- Closely collaborate with Data Platform & Delivery teams on technical matters related to Data Quality and translate that into your teams for execution.
- Provide an improved Data Operations client experience.
- Make sure the circle is doing the right things right, i.e. competent and capable and focus on the right priorities in order to achieve their goals

Rewards & benefits
We want to make sure that it’s possible for you to strike the right balance between your career and your private life. You can find out more about our employment conditions here.
The benefits of working with us at ING include:
- A salary tailored to your qualities and experience (GJA 18)
- 36 or 40 hour workweek
- Individual leave: 24+2 individual holiday days based on 36 hr workweek
- Diversity leave: 3 days per year (1,5 paid, 1,5 unpaid)
- CSR days: up to 2 days per year to actively engage in society by volunteering
- 13th month salary
- 8% Holiday payment
- Individual Savings Contribution (BIS), 3.5% of your gross annual salary
- Mobility card
- Attractive pension scheme
